Analysis

Saudi Arabia recorded 0.2% for broad money growth in 2017. That is the lowest value across all 57 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 72.5% on the previous year and down 99.3% over ten years.

Over the whole period, broad money growth in Saudi Arabia peaked at 81.9% in 1975 and was at its lowest, 0.2%, in 2017.

That places Saudi Arabia 161st out of 166 countries with data for 2017,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Broad money growth in Saudi Arabia, year by year

Annual values for Broad money growth (annual %) in Saudi Arabia, 1961 to 2017.
Year annual % Change
1961 9.0%
1962 11.2% +24.0%
1963 20.7% +85.0%
1964 8.4% -59.4%
1965 11.8% +39.9%
1966 18.5% +57.1%
1967 14.3% -22.7%
1968 15.7% +10.2%
1969 5.9% -62.4%
1970 6.0% +1.8%
1971 14.1% +134.0%
1972 40.6% +188.7%
1973 35.1% -13.6%
1974 43.5% +24.2%
1975 81.9% +88.0%
1976 66.5% -18.8%
1977 53.9% -19.0%
1978 27.4% -49.2%
1979 13.7% -50.0%
1980 17.4% +26.7%
1981 33.0% +90.1%
1982 20.2% -38.8%
1983 10.7% -46.8%
1984 6.0% -43.9%
1985 1.1% -81.0%
1986 9.2% +707.4%
1987 4.1% -55.4%
1988 6.4% +56.0%
1989 0.9% -86.4%
1990 4.6% +424.7%
1991 14.6% +217.6%
1992 2.1% -85.9%
1993 3.4% +64.5%
1994 3.0% -11.7%
1995 3.4% +12.4%
1996 7.3% +116.2%
1997 5.2% -28.2%
1998 3.6% -30.3%
1999 6.8% +88.2%
2000 4.5% -34.7%
2001 5.1% +13.9%
2002 15.2% +198.8%
2003 8.5% -44.1%
2004 17.3% +103.1%
2005 13.2% -23.2%
2006 20.4% +54.1%
2007 20.1% -1.3%
2008 18.0% -10.8%
2009 10.8% -39.8%
2010 5.2% -52.2%
2011 13.3% +156.4%
2012 16.5% +24.4%
2013 8.4% -49.3%
2014 11.8% +41.6%
2015 2.9% -75.4%
2016 0.5% -81.1%
2017 0.2% -72.5%

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s 12.8% 5.9% 20.7% 9
1970s 38.3% 6.0% 81.9% 10
1980s 10.9% 0.9% 33.0% 10
1990s 5.4% 2.1% 14.6% 10
2000s 13.3% 4.5% 20.4% 10
2010s 7.3% 0.2% 16.5% 8

Broad money is the sum of all liquid financial instruments held by money-holding sectors that are widely accepted in an economy as a medium of exchange, plus those that can be converted into a medium of exchange at short notice at, or close to, their full nominal value. This indicator denotes the percentage change over each previous year of the constant price (base year 2015) series in United States dollars.
